Went with the husky ones. The drivers side was perfect, but the passenger side needed to be trimmed to fit inside the fender. I could see a line on the wheel well but it doesn't look like it was cut very accurately. I just trimmed it down with a dremmel. Also the rear bolt hole didnt line up 100% so i just drilled through it some to make it work.

After those two modifications i'm happy with them for $92 off amazon. Thanks for the help guys!
